doing an x3 build, can i have some recommendations for a tail servo that is happy at 6v. On a bit of a budget, so nothing too deer if possible. Probably be using a spartan vx1e as fbl unit.
thanks
I'm slowly picking up parts for an X3 myself, for the tail I found a second hand DS95i, but that's not a budget servo :-) A lot of folks on helifreak really rate the TGY-306 servos. Apparently it's worth opening them up to do a couple of mods to prolong their life (foam insulation to protect the mainboard from case vibrations I believe), but they have a lot of fans with people running hundreds or thousands of flights with these on both cyclic and tail:
you can change a couple of the gears in the 306 servo with ds95i gears and then it will have the performance of a ds95i, there is a thread on HF about it
I had a TGY-306G HV on mine, but I was getting wagging in backward flight an funnels, even at quite low gain settings. I switched to a DS95i and now my gain is much higher with no sign of any wag. The tail feels better, giving you the confidence fly it harder.
Best I've heard of, is the MKS 8910A+, that's supposed to be even better than the DS95i on the X3.
On a budget, I'd try the 306G for about £15 especially if you can get the DS95i gears in it, or an Align DS525M for about £25.
